Garda Remuneration

Dáil Éireann Debate, Tuesday - 16 April 2013

Tuesday, 16 April 2013

Questions (860)

Robert Dowds

Question:

860. Deputy Robert Dowds asked the Minister for Justice and Equality if he will give consideration to amending the proposed changes in the pay and conditions of members of An Garda Síochána to better reflect the anti-social hours of work which Gardaí must do, the danger that Gardaí put themselves in to protect the public and to tackle the ongoing problem of poor morale amongst Gardaí;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[16523/13]

View answer

Written answers

Both the Commissioner and I are always available to engage in constructive and meaningful discussions on matters affecting the members of the Garda Síochána. However, the proposals which emerged from the discussions in Lansdowne House stand and it would be inappropriate to make any further comment on this matter at this particular time.
